December 21, 20178 yr 3 minutes ago, Dane Franco said: I was referring to temporary jigs I made a "lazy susan" assembly table due to the extremely small area I have to work in. Temporary jigs are nailed, taped or screwed to the plywood surface. They only last long enough to do the task and then are scrapped so I can continue using the table.
December 21, 20178 yr My kinda jig. Unless it's something I"m going to use over and over, I am not going to spend half a day making a jig to save 30 seconds. Thinking of my jigs Sliding crosscut table -- if I'm not ripping, I'm using it Second sliding crosscut table -- use this one for large pieces (>18" wide) or bevel cuts Miter sliding table -- picture frames and mitered corners Raised panel jig -- holds the piece clamped down at 10 degrees -- don't have to tilt the saw blade and worry about the piece slipping down the insdert Biscuiting jig - clamps pieces down so I can put two hands on the tool Spline-key cutter (this was a 10 minute jig that I've used dozens of times)
